I can think of two things that might do that.
First, under "Edit Options" on the left nav in the User CP you must have both the "Receive e-mails from Administrators" checked and the "Default Thread Subscription Mode" to accept e-mails, either "Instant E-mail Notification", "Daily E-Mail Notification" or "Weekly E-mail Notification" (sounds like you want Instant.) I am not sure when changing this it re-applies to all current subs (matter of fact, I bet it doesn't) so in the Subscription page here (http://www.bmwmoa.org/forum/subscription.php) make sure the "Notification" boxes are checked for the threads for which you want notifications.
Second - you might have a spam filter and not even know it. A friend of mine recently discovered he had one when all e-mail to him started bouncing because he had unknowingly used up his whole disk quota - turned out to be a spam folder he didn't know he had and after talking to his service's tech folks, found he could only reach by logging into the mail server's webmail and emptying it by hand. ISP companies buy so-called blacklists from services that track spam on the web, often when a website moves servers it inherits a new IP address in a range previously used by a spammer and unfortunately the mail it now sends gets caught by services using that particular list. Also, some anti-spam services analyze traffic for spam patterns, and auto-mailers from forums often are mis-identified as spam.
If it is neither of these, there may well be a problem with the software (one I saw recently was a hard space after the address that caused the e-mail to bounce.)
